About the Opportunity 


We have an exciting opportunity for an experienced & technically sound Pricing Data Analyst - to join our Pricing & Customer Value team, a business partnering function within the Commercial division of Supermarkets.  


The Pricing & Customer Value team business partners within the Buying division of Supermarkets, Woolworths Food Company, Finance, IT & Strategy teams. As a team, we support the optimisation of pricing opportunities for the Woolworths Supermarkets division with a strong focus on building continued price trust with our customers and maintaining Woolworths’ competitiveness in the market. 


The purpose of this role is to support the optimisation of pricing opportunities for the Woolworths Supermarkets Division with a strong focus on building continued price trust with our customers and maintaining Woolworths’ competitiveness in the market.


Our team of analysts are trusted business partners to a wide group of stakeholders and are strongly connected to the development and delivery of the strategic & commercial direction of the business. 


What you’ll do


  • Framing problems, gathering and analysing complex data, and developing insights and recommendations to support the Pricing & Customer Value team’s mandate within the business

  • Becoming a trusted advisor to the Commercial team, by injecting analytical rigour and innovative thinking into the issues the business faces, and proactively finding and landing opportunities to add value

  • Scoping, developing and maintaining various solutions for the business, including models, reports, and dashboards

  • Contributing to the knowledge environment within the Pricing & Customer Value team and the broader Buying team, including training team members and business partners in new concepts and solutions

  • Fostering a culture of continuous improvement and innovation


What You’ll Bring


  • 1-3 years experience in a data analytics role where you managed large data sets and developed complex analysis

  • Build strong relationships and trust with key stakeholders 

  • Must be proficient with SQL 

  • Strong database management experience, ideally using a system such as Google Cloud Platform (BigQuery/TableAu/Dataprep)

  • Advanced in MS Excel (including modelling)/ Google Sheets and MS Powerpoint / Google Slides

  • Be an advocate for our customers and understand the market context in which we operate

  • Proven ability to draw on data and analysis to develop actionable insights and recommendations

  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, and ability to establish and maintain strong partnerships with stakeholders

  • Experience partnering with commercial teams within a retail or FMCG environment would be highly beneficial.
